  1. Peru birding Tour is an Awesome Act while Visiting to Peru Our birdwatching tours to Peru are a popular place to start. Manu National Park is one of the greatest protected areas on the planet, covering the entire elevational transect from the Amazonian lowlands up to the highest elevations in the Andes. A series of nice lodges makes it a joy to visit, and every day offers something special, from displaying cocks-of-the-rock to parrot licks, canopy towers, and flocks of jewel-like tanagers.

  2. The ancient city of Cuzco and its mountainous surroundings offer totally different birds as well as ruins and vibrant culture. We’ll devote a morning to a guided tour of Machu Picchu, and also visit the threatened Polylepis forests nearby.

  3. Northern Peru has made huge strides in recent years in terms of accommodation – we stay in some very nice lodges, many with superb feeders, and no camping is necessary. Habitat diversity is very high, and we’ll visit the deserts and dry forest of the northwest, coastal wetlands, montane scrub, the Marañon Valley with its numerous endemics, the lush cloudforests of the east slope of the Andes during rainbow mountain tours, and even spend a few days on the Andean altipano.

  4. ​MarvelousSpatuletail tops a long list of memorable birds we’ll be looking for, but just to mention a few others: White-winged Guan, Black-cowledSaltator, MarañonCrescentchest, Buff-bridled Inca-Finch, Long-whiskered Owlet, Royal Sunangel, Ochre-fronted Antpitta, Fiery-throated Fruiteater, and Yellow-faced Parrotlet. A few long drives are necessary, but the birding is easy on most days, with trails required on only a few days.
